NIST Artificial Intelligence Risk Management Framework (AI RMF)

The NIST AI RMF framework helps organizations identify and plan for risks posed by using generative AI.

It promotes trustworthy and responsible AI development and use. Key components include:

  • Risk Identification and Assessment
  • Risk Management Strategies
  • Governance and Accountability
  • Trustworthy AI
